§ 25-5. Appraisal prior to sale of city-owned real estate.

No city-owned real estate with an estimated value exceeding ten thousand dollars ($10,000.00) shall be purchased, sold, or traded without first obtaining an appraisal of the value of said property by a neutral certified commercial real estate appraiser.
(Ord. No. 97-38, § I, 8-12-97)
Editor's note
Ord. No. 97-38, § I, adopted Aug. 12, 1997, did not specifically amend the Code; therefore, these provisions have been included as § 25-5, at the editor's discretion.
